The approach can vary, such as asking trainees to stop briefly a microlecture video clip or including a countdown timer in the video clip to force a pause factor. The system-made time out offers students with an opportunity for clarifying their understanding of today information. Video lectures with system-paced stops briefly have been revealed to substantially raise learning when contrasted with talks without stops or those that allow learner-paced stops briefly.
This approach motivates students to check out as well as articulate freshly formed links (Educational videos for children). Empirical research reveals that students find out better from an instructional video that requires them to clarify the material. Time out for one to 2 minutes numerous times, encouraging pupils to make note in a skeletal overview of what they have actually picked up from the coming before content.
